It is expensive and TRUPANION doesn't cover basic procedures such as the VET EXAMINATIONS!
It's expensive and there are many basic things that this insurance doesn't cover, for example, the VET EXAMINATION! I pay a monthly fee of $150 for two cats, (NOT SENIOR). One of them had to have surgery because a "foreign object" was discovered in his small intestine. IT WAS AN EMERGENCY, but they don't cover that assessment. I understand that there is a deductible of $300, so... You think about it. Is it worth it to pay expensive insurance for then discover that you have to pay for such an important-basic-NECESSARY procedure from your own pocket???? No, it is not worth it.

Yet Another Rate Increase !
Yet another rate increase with no change in coverage. Worthwhile, that is the question with increases follows: 2021 $109/yr 2022 $129/yr and then in 2023 $150/yr!!! That's a whopping $41 increase in 2 years …??? Being retired & on a fixed income , I am forced to seriously consider cancelling policy in favour of automatic savings account or other household savings. It should be noted that Increases over time are expected but ...those in line with inflation would be more palatable hence the mediocre rating. Otherwise, Trupanion meets contractual obligations of processing & coverage in timely manner.

Clam processing taking much longer
I have had good experiences with this insurance company up until now. My dog recently had an intestinal blockage that needed surgery to remove. It’s coming up on a month since I filed the claim and all I have gotten is a sorry for the delay letter. When you call, it’s like they are reading from a script, they just keep repeating it takes 15 to 45 days to process claims and more complex claims take more time. I take that to mean the more we have to pay out the more time it takes. They need to keep their clients better informed throughout the claim process of any delays and why they are happening. Very disappointing this time.
